An upgrade route for fan convectors

Rinnai
Making it easy to upgrade to its powered-flue heaters from old balanced-flue systems, Rinnai offers a flue-conversion kit.
To enable old, balanced-flue heating systems to be replaced with its powered-flue units, Rinnai UK has developed a flue-conversion kit. The pack contained everything an installer needs to replace traditional-style wall-mounted balanced-flue convector heaters with 250 mm flue holes. It eliminates the need for additional filling or making good the large flue hole required by the older heaters. The kit also contains a wall bracket for converting from floor-mounted to wall-hung boilers. These flue adaptors consist of an external and internal filler plate, optional terminal guard, all fixing screws and instructions.
